After investing umpteen millions in the upgrade of its fluidized bed reactors (#FBR technology) and post-treatment systems for granular #polysilicon in Moses Lake, Washington (USA), REC Silicon suddenly announced on December 30 that it would cease its polysilicon production. The decision comes after a first qualification test for REC Silicon’s granular material in #China failed in December. The company’s argument, however, that its only polysilicon customer Qcells USA Corp., a subsidiary of Hanwha Group, “is not able to wait any longer for delivery of product” is strange as the start-up of #ingot and #wafer production at Qcells has been delayed to mid-2025. And there are more crudities. Something smells foul here. REC Silicon – Results of Qualification Test

Moses Lake, Washington USA December 17, 2024: REC Silicon ASA (“REC Silicon” or the “Company”) has now received the results from the qualification test for its ultra-high purity polysilicon from the recently restarted silane-based high-purity granular production facility in Moses Lake, Washington.

The Company was notified yesterday by its customer of the results from the qualification test that was completed earlier this month through a third-party testing partner. Unfortunately, due to the impurity issues in the qualification material sent, the customer deemed the test to be unsuccessful. This was due to lower-than-expected levels of crystallization and the ingot yield observed in the testing runs, which the customer deemed not to be acceptable for their production process at this stage. The Company is in discussions with its customer to determine the feasibility of another test which will be contingent upon the Company making improvements in the manufacturing process at Moses Lake. The timing and likelihood of achieving the necessary improvements is uncertain at this point in time.

As a result of the unsuccessful qualification test, REC Silicon is reviewing multiple strategic options. This may include additional operational adjustments, contractual re-negotiations, and other mitigative actions.

REC Silicon continues to work on additional financing to ensure the Company’s financial flexibility. The Company will provide additional operational and financing details when such information becomes available.

REC Silicon – Update Regarding First Shipment of Ultra-High Purity Polysilicon

Moses Lake, Washington USA – September 13, 2024: REC Silicon ASA (“REC Silicon” or the “Company”) provides an operational update concerning the first shipment of ultra-high purity polysilicon from the recently restarted silane-based high-purity granular production facility in Moses Lake, Washington.

The Company is pleased to announce that following a series of modifications and mitigations in our process aimed at addressing a previously announced issue around higher than expected levels of an impurity in the product, all impurities have now been reduced to levels that are acceptable to our customer, and we have an agreement in principle to modify a specification subject to a final evaluation and qualification test, as is typical in the industry after such a modification.

The plant is running well, and the facility is now producing volumes for commercial shipments. Even though our production volumes are being ramped to the necessary level already, the first commercial shipment of product will need to be delayed to mid-October, to accommodate this final qualification step that our customer is undertaking.

Additionally, we can confirm that construction activities related to the restart of the Moses Lake facility are complete, including Silane IV and equipment will be started as needed during the planned ramp of capacity.

“Getting to this point and mitigating the previous impurity issue was the result of hard work by many dedicated personnel of the Company. We will soon be beginning a new phase for the facility where efforts are transitioning to continuous quality improvement to exceed the market standard, ramp-up, and optimization. There is still a large amount of work to be accomplished. We will strive to reach our full commercial production capacity as soon as we can while maintaining our focus on product quality. We appreciate the interactions with our customer in getting to this stage, our discussions have always centered around our aligned interests of our polysilicon enabling their efforts to create a complete PV solar value chain in the USA. This is demonstrably a positive outcome for both parties” says CEO Kurt Levens.
